Beyond the Traditional Electronic Spreadsheet: How XBRL Can Help Industrialize Financial Information Processing

In simple terms, XBRL introduces a global, open industry standard alternative to certain specific traditional electronic spreadsheet use cases. Think of it as a set of digital "information Legos." While traditional spreadsheets are incredibly flexible, that very flexibility makes them a liability for mission-critical tasks, especially when reliable processing by artificial intelligence (AI) is necessary.

These modular standardized digital building blocks solve a fundamental problem that traditional spreadsheets cannot solve effectively. Spreadsheets are notoriously difficult to control because they lack consistent common structure and lack common expression of meaning. This "formatting freedom" allowed to business professionals creating these traditional spreadsheets makes it incredibly hard for machines to accurately interpret the information conveyed by those spreadsheets. In fact, a PwC study revealed that AI has only about a 74% accuracy rate when interpreting traditional electronic spreadsheets. Worse yet, you have no way of knowing which 74% the AI got right and which parts are wrong.

Stripping Away the Document "Costume"

The root of the issue is that traditional spreadsheets are designed as documents first and data structures second. To fix this, we need to strip away the document "costume" and isolate the raw information underneath. By thinking beyond the document, we can give AI a genuine chance to succeed.

Consider this striking example: the IT consultancy Gartner estimates that a typical Fortune 1000 company relies on roughly 800 individual spreadsheets just to assemble its external compliance reports. These spreadsheets are stitched together by what amounts to an expensive, human "bucket brigade". Reliably connecting 800 separate files is nearly impossible; any links that do exist are brittle, unstable, and prone to breaking. Digital information Legos can replace this fragmented approach with a scalable, industrial-strength framework and system.

This shift is critical when you look at the risks involved. A 2024 multi-university study found that 94% of traditional spreadsheets used in business decision-making contain errors, many of them critical. This is just one of many studies highlighting how error-prone spreadsheets are in operational environments.

From "Craft" to "Industrial System"

The traditional spreadsheet is an evolutionary step, not the final destination. The next logical step is to transition from ad-hoc, "craft-based" processes which rely heavily on individual skill, judgment, and memory into standardized, repeatable, and highly efficient industrial processes.

To industrialize information management means turning it into a routinized, reliable process. This requires five core pillars:

  • Standardization: Defining clear steps so work is executed identically every time.
  • Repeatability: Ensuring any person (or machine) can follow the process and achieve the exact same result.
  • Scale: Designing the process to run smoothly hundreds or thousands of times, not just once.
  • Efficiency: Stripping away unnecessary variation, waste, and improvisation.
  • System Over Craft: Moving away from a dependency on individual memory and toward a documented, automated, and controlled system.

A Simple Metaphor: If you cook a meal from memory, that’s craft. If you write a detailed recipe that anyone can follow, that’s standardization. If you build a commercial kitchen that predictably produces 500 identical quality meals a day, that’s industrialization.

The New Accounting Tool in the Toolset

The traditional electronic spreadsheet is the ultimate "Swiss Army knife" for accountants, and it isn't going away anytime soon. However, for mission-critical, high-stakes data environments, a more robust, maintainable, and modular global open industry standard is finally arriving to take its place.

Think of it.  The smart audit bundle.  The smart closing book.  The smart financial statement. Smart financial analysis models. Modular open systems that  can be linked together effectively, can be easily documented, can be easily controlled, information is linked together; all because they were designed that way from the ground up.

Incorporate things like Lean Six Sigma mistake proofing and Agile approaches, techniques, and philosophies and all this gets even better.
